- auth2.GetTokenInfo兼容V1 token

This commit is contained in:
gazebo
2019-03-11 15:27:23 +08:00
parent cd4bc1c810
commit c8946137fd

View File

@@ -81,7 +81,11 @@ func (c *Auth2Controller) Login() {
// @router /GetTokenInfo [get]
func (c *Auth2Controller) GetTokenInfo() {
c.callGetTokenInfo(func(params *tAuth2GetTokenInfoParams) (retVal interface{}, errCode string, err error) {
retVal, err = auth2.GetTokenInfo(params.Token)
if auth2.IsV2Token(params.Token) {
retVal, err = auth2.GetTokenInfo(params.Token)
} else {
retVal, err = auth.GetUserInfo(params.Token)
}
return retVal, "", err
})
}